To select the optimal graph for illustrating student counts across distinct school streams, analyze graph type attributes:

  • Bar Graph: Best for comparing distinct data sets. Individual bars represent categories, facilitating clear quantity comparison.
  • Pie Chart: Useful for demonstrating fractional contributions to a total. Slices depict categories' proportions relative to the entirety.
  • Line Graph: Primarily for tracking patterns across continuous scales or time. Unsuitable for unordered, discrete categories.
  • None of them: Applicable if standard graph types fail to accurately depict the data.

Considering the data comprises discrete categories (school streams) and the objective is to compare student numbers within them, a Bar Graph is the most fitting choice. This format enables straightforward comparison of student enrollment across the different streams.
